About the role

Laars Heating Systems, based in Rochester, NH, is seeking a Manufacturing Engineer to evaluate requirements, make recommendations, and manage projects related to Lean Initiatives, Safety, Quality, and Productivity improvement projects, scrap reduction projects, and new equipment procurement.

Responsibilities

  • Develop and implement new manufacturing processes and technologies to support strategic objectives.
  • Manage updates and modifications to existing manufacturing processes to support new product launches, including review of new part prints and design for manufacturability.
  • Create cost comparisons and return on investment calculations to assist in supplier selection.
  • Act as a subject matter expert for interdepartmental projects and initiatives.
  • Create standardized processes, including all documentation, to ensure the highest quality, cost-effectiveness, and efficiency.
  • Partner with quality to create comprehensive control plans and quality checks to ensure a robust process delivers good product to customers, accounting for required quality inspector checks.
  • Provide training and support to production personnel on troubleshooting techniques and equipment operation.
  • Develop and maintain process documentation, including standard operating procedures (SOPs), work instructions, Process Flow Diagrams, PFMEA, and Process Control Plans.
  • Generate reports and present data on process performance and improvement initiatives.
  • Collaborate with design engineers, production personnel, quality control, and other departments to resolve process-related issues and ensure smooth production operations.
  • Support the day-to-day needs of operations to help the team meet KPIs and ensure standardization across all lines.
  • Lead Root Cause Failure Analysis efforts to ensure robust corrective actions are implemented.
  • Coordinate with maintenance, production, and engineering for any major changes to equipment.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in engineering or another related technical field.
  • 5-10 years’ experience in a fast-paced, customer-focused manufacturing environment.
  • Knowledge of engineering and manufacturing practices and processes, including Lean Manufacturing and techniques.
  • Ability to read prints and understand geometric dimensions and tolerances.
  • Proficient in standard business-related computer software such as Word, Excel, Microsoft Outlook, and SolidWorks.
  • Experience leading Kaizen initiatives.
  • Strong continuous improvement and problem-solving skills.
  • Effective communication skills to collaborate with cross-functional teams and present complex technical information.
  • Self-motivated, detail-oriented, and capable of working independently and as part of a team.
  • Ability to lead teams without direct authority.
